SEDEILLAN, Gisela. El desafío de revertir la congestión de los tribunales bonaerenses a comienzos del siglo XX: la mirada en el desempeño judicial. Rev. hist. derecho [online]. 2015, n.50. ISSN 1853-1784.
A slow moving judicial system, overloaded criminal courts and poor performance of court staff became constant questionings of the problematic affecting the judicial system of the Buenos Aires province during the first decade of the twentieth century. In order to streamline processes and decompress the overcrowded prisons the province government prioritized reforms to the criminal justice system administration. Historiography has usually focus on pointing out the changes introduced to the criminal law. However, it remains to be analyzed the extent of the reform atmosphere impact on addressing pending shortcomings such as the increasing of the judicial staff and judicial structure and the strengthening of the judicial budget. With the intention of identifying the projected and accomplished reforms we will focus on the analysis of the debates held at the legislature of the Buenos Aires province.
Palavras-chave : Criminal justice - Judicial delays - Legislature - Province of Buenos Aires.
